Allow screen rotating during (possible) password prompting
Use case Password entering is currently unneccesary difficult
Proposed Solution When the user is prompted to enter a password, e.g. when requesting the OAuth-authorisation (which looks like being delegated by SCEE (SC, too?) to a browser instance), enable screen rotating. Screen rotating is apparently disabled when executing SCEE (SC, too?) for whatever reason, but consider enabling it during a password prompt.
Why? Some virtual keyboards offer different keyboard layouts depending on whether screen is rotated in landscape or portrait mode. In my case, only in landscape mode I got an ample, more PC-like keyboard layout. Most passwords are memorised not in a direct char by char manner, but rather in shapes the fingers move around or as combination of basic chars and held modifier keys. Thus, to me it is almost impossible to enter a passwort using a virtual keyboard in portrait mode orientation.
Just to be clear: By "enabled screen rotating" I mean the feature that screen content and layout is following the orientation the device is held.
Note: I am not a SC user, but a SCEE one. Hence I first stated this issue there. Ref. https://github.com/Helium314/SCEE/issues/616
@AlecsSantos why you are linking this file? Looks like typical attempt to get people installing malware.
@others how you can check whether user commented before on issue tracker? To me it looks like a clear spam (and I marked it as such) but it would be nice to double-check before blocking user and deleting message altogether.
I am thinking about banning and deleting even if they contributed before, as handling of account taken over.
EDIT: deleted now as malware spamlink
Haven't downloaded the file but pretty sure it's malware. Please at least hide the post
No previous comments: https://github.com/streetcomplete/StreetComplete/issues?q=commenter%3AAlecsSantos
Account created: July 27, 2023
@riQQ It is hidden since I posted my comment. I will delete it now and hide posts about it.
@everyone - please do not download and install stuff just because someone told you to do this
Currently, the whole Profile/Login screen is locked to portrait orientation. This basically had historic reasons because some layouts did not work for landscape mode. However, as I reimplemented this all in compose, and this time I took care that all layouts well work in any display orientation, the locking to portrait orientation can be removed. This can be done after #5595 is finished.